消除"對(duì)于類成員的引用所產(chǎn)生的二義"是不考慮訪問權(quán)限,可以歸結(jié)為:改變一個(gè)類成員的訪問權(quán)限不應(yīng)改變程序的含義。
當(dāng)一個(gè)派生類繼承了兩個(gè)基類而這兩個(gè)積累正好又有兩個(gè)成員函數(shù)的聲明是相同的時(shí)后會(huì)發(fā)生潛在的二義性問題,只有當(dāng)派生類調(diào)用該函數(shù)的時(shí)候才會(huì)體現(xiàn)出來。如果其中一個(gè)基類的成員函數(shù)為私有的,另一個(gè)基類為共有的,此時(shí)二義性仍然不能消除掉。